The International Longshore and Warehouse Union says that its members and the BC Maritime Employers Association came to a tentative agreement at 10:20 am on July 13, 2023, with both parties accepting the Terms of Settlement from federal mediators. This brings an end to the job action that started 13 days ago.
“The Surrey Board of Trade is pleased that a tentative agreement has been reached to end the strike with a four-year deal, however, ratification is still to occur,” said Jasroop Gosal, Policy & Research Manager of the Surrey Board of Trade. “We look forward to the resumption of operations as soon as possible. The strike’s impact was significant, and it will still affect businesses and consumers as the market reacts. We hope that the government of Canada will work with the business community to repair the international relationships and Canada’s reputation that have been damaged.”
Details of the agreement are not yet known to the public.
